Study on the platform to support wise use of personal information in the data portability era
Project Outline
"Comprehensive Personal Information (CI-PI)" can be generated by introducing data portability (DP). This is a new information asset created by an individual by exercising the right of DP himself, through collecting and integrating fragmentarypersonal information generated in the process of service provision.
This project will conductscenario analysis and impact analysis from three viewpoints of individual (consumer), enterprise/industry, and society/public with respect to generation, distribution and use of CI-PI. Based on that analysis, we designed a CI-PI distribution and utilization mechanism as a social system and developed a platform consisting of software and expert communities to support dialogue between individuals (consumers), companies, and society/public to support the realization of wise use.
